WebDirections To Dehydrate Rhubarb. 1. Slice off the ends of your rhubarb and dice into even size pieces. I keep mine about 1/4″ thick. You want all your pieces to be fairly close in size so that they dry evenly. I slice all of mine with a mandolin slicer because it keeps them even. WebFeb 12, 2024 · Dry at 135 ºF/57 ºC overnight or until fruit is dry and leathery. Depending on the moisture and sugar content, dehydrating pears should take between 10 to 24 hours. Sweeter fruits dry more slowly because the sugar bonds to the water. Dehydrated pears should be flexible and not too sticky. Store in an airtight container.
